Four Seasons Hotel Taipei (Chinese: 元利四季酒店) is an under-construction skyscraper hotel located in Xinyi Planning District, Xinyi District, Taipei, Taiwan.[2] The hotel held its groundbreaking ceremony on 2 January 2022 and is estimated to be completed by 2025.[3] Upon completion, it will have a height of 180 m (590 ft), comprising 31 floors above ground and 4 below ground.[4] The hotel is constructed by Yuanlih Group and jointly designed by Yabu Pushelberg and Richard Rogers.[5][6]
The hotel is located directly opposite to Taipei 101 in the Xinyi Planning District, which contains numerous shopping centres, entertainment venues and tourist attractions, such as the Taipei World Trade Center, National Sun Yat-sen Memorial Hall and Taipei 101.[7] It is one minute's walk from Taipei 101–World Trade Center metro station.[8]
Four Seasons Hotel Taipei will be operated by Four Seasons Hotels and Resorts and will offer a total of 260 guest rooms and suites with city and mountain views, spanning a total of 31 floors.[9] Aside from accommodation, the hotel will also include three restaurants, three bars and lounges, a fitness center, an outdoor pool and spa, two ballrooms, as well as meeting and event spaces.[10]
